Im thinking of replacing the standard RCD300, but keep it to put back in when I sell the car later on. Question is where and in what form is the security code for this. Should it be in the owners leather manual somewhere, or a code attached to the spare key, or printed on a credit card sized piece of card?

Anyone got an example of how many letters / numbers so I know what Im looking for?

Mine has four numbers on a card that's at the front of the owners manual.

Well I dont seem to have such card, only one card which was for VW assistance. Will the original VW dealer have it on their system or is there any other way of "obtaining" such code?

dealer sohuld have it on their system - just pop in with your reg and chassis number and they'll get hold of it for you.

Make sure they don't charge you for it mind!
